From: Luis Chamberlain Date: Fri, 15 Oct 2021 23:30:22 +0000 (-0700) Subject: dm: add add_disk() error handling X-Git-Tag: block-5.16-2021-11-13~14^2~8 X-Git-Url: https://git.kernel.dk/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=089975379d52e7b99f2baf76e0d45bf2176be2bf;p=linux-2.6-block.git dm: add add_disk() error handling We never checked for errors on add_disk() as this function returned void. Now that this is fixed, use the shiny new error handling. There are two calls to dm_setup_md_queue() which can fail then, one on dm_early_create() and we can easily see that the error path there calls dm_destroy in the error path. The other use case is on the ioctl table_load case. If that fails userspace needs to call the DM_DEV_REMOVE_CMD to cleanup the state - similar to any other failure.
